摘要
Synthesis of adipic acid by catalytic oxidation of cyclohexanone with 30% hydrogen peroxide in the presence of sodium tungstate catalyst can be well performed under reflux temperature. The adipic acid isolated yield reaches to 82.1%, and the purity of the product is also very high. The catalytic oxidation reaction takes place without any organic solvent and phase-transfer agent. The effects over different acidic ligands and the amount of the ligand on the catalytic oxidation were investigated. The catalysts exhibit high activity for the catalytic oxidation reaction of the mixture of cyclohexanone and cyclohexanol to adipic acid by 30% hydrogen peroxide under reflux temperature.
